Kevel's APIs make it easy for engineers and PMs to build their own server-side, fully-customized ad server. Top e-retailers and user communities use Kevel to build innovative ad servers to promote anything from native ads to internal content to sponsored listings.

Engineers reliably see a 90%+ reduction in dev time using Kevel's APIs versus doing it entirely from scratch. Kevel's customer list includes Fortune 500 brands, public companies, and unicorn startups, including Klarna, Yelp, Edmunds, Bed Bath & Beyond, Ticketmaster, Wattpad, imgur, Strava, and many more.

A Beginner’s Guide to Ad Servers (Plus: 8 Ad Servers Reviewed)
Adzerk is a suite of APIs that make it easy for engineers and PMs to design, build, and launch a fully-customized, server-side ad server. Sold as an infrastructure-as-a-service for enterprises, plans start in the $3K-$5K/month range and scale based on needed features and monthly request volume.
